Job Duties
- Ensure culinary production appropriately connects to the Executional Framework
- Ensure proper culinary standards and techniques are in place for preparation of food items including production, presentation, and service standards
- Manage a culinary team including chef managers and hourly staff to ensure quality in final presentation of food
- Train and manage culinary and kitchen employees to use best practice food production techniques
- Coach employees by creating a shared understanding about what needs to be achieved and how it is to be achieved
- Reward and recognize employees
- Plan and execute team meetings and daily huddles
